Choosing the Right Epoxy System for Your Garage

Modern garage interior with uniform grey epoxy flooring

Solid Colour Epoxy

This is your straightforward, no-fuss option. Pick a colour - grey, tan, or blue are popular - and get a uniform finish across your entire garage floor. Solid-colour epoxy works well if you want a clean, professional look with minimal visual interest. The coating still gives you all the durability and chemical resistance, just without decorative elements.

Double garage with multicoloured vinyl flake epoxy flooring

Flake Epoxy Systems

Flake systems use colored vinyl chips broadcast into the wet epoxy. These chips add texture for slip resistance and hide any imperfections in your concrete. You can go light with the flakes for a subtle speckled look, or heavy for full coverage where you can barely see the base color underneath.

High-end garage showroom with metallic epoxy flooring

Metallic Epoxy Flooring

Metallic systems create that swirled, three-dimensional effect you see in high-end showrooms. The installer mixes metallic pigments into the epoxy, then manipulates them during application to create unique patterns. No two metallic floors look exactly the same. Popular with car enthusiasts who want their garage to match the quality of what's parked inside.

Durability Against Oil Stains and Chemicals

Epoxy creates a non-porous barrier that stops liquids from soaking into your concrete. Oil drips, brake fluid, antifreeze – these substances just pool on the surface until you wipe them away. No staining, no permanent damage.

The chemical resistance comes from the epoxy’s molecular structure. Once cured, the coating resists:

  • Engine oils and transmission fluids
  • Battery acid and coolants
  • Cleaning solvents and degreasers
  • De-icing salts and road chemicals
  • Fertilisers and garden chemicals

Spills that would permanently stain bare concrete wiped clean with a rag on epoxy flooring.

The Installation Process Explained

Getting epoxy installed right takes more time than slapping down paint, but that’s why it lasts years instead of peeling off in months.

Key Installation Steps:

  • Diamond grinding opens concrete pores for proper bonding
  • Crack filling and oil stain treatment
  • The primer application creates an initial chemical bond
  • Base coat with decorative flakes or metallic pigments
  • Clear topcoat sealing with slip-resistant additives
  • 5-7 day cure time before vehicle traffic

The process takes 1-2 days for installation, then another week for full curing in Ipswich’s climate conditions.

Maintenance and Longevity

Epoxy flooring requires minimal upkeep to maintain its appearance. Regular sweeping keeps grit from scratching the surface, and warm, soapy water handles most cleaning needs. Oil spills wipe away easily without leaving marks.

High-quality epoxy in residential garages lasts for years before requiring attention. The coating doesn’t fail suddenly – you’ll see gradual dulling of the shine first. When that happens, a fresh topcoat brings everything back without redoing the whole system, extending life another several years at a fraction of replacement cost.

Common Questions About Epoxy Garage Flooring

Can epoxy be installed over existing coatings?

Sometimes yes, sometimes no. If there’s old paint or sealer on your concrete, it usually needs removing first. Epoxy won’t bond properly to these coatings, so grinding them off is required. Epoxy can go over old epoxy if it’s still well-adhered and in good condition.

What about slip resistance?

Standard epoxy can be slippery when wet. Most installers add anti-slip additives to the topcoat to create texture. The amount of additive adjusts the grip level – more additive means more traction but a slightly rougher feel underfoot.

Does epoxy work in outdoor areas?

Epoxy can be used on covered outdoor concrete, like carports or patios. Direct sun exposure causes UV degradation over time, making the coating yellow and eventually fail. For outdoor areas with sun exposure, polyaspartic topcoats provide better UV resistance.

What if my concrete is cracked?

Small cracks get filled during preparation. Larger cracks might need routing out and filling with flexible sealant before epoxy goes down. If your concrete has major structural cracks or movement issues, those need addressing before any coating gets applied.

Can I install epoxy myself?

DIY epoxy kits exist, but professional installation produces much better results. The surface prep requires proper equipment – diamond grinders, not just floor sanders. Application technique matters too, especially for even coverage and proper curing. Most DIY jobs end up with bonding failures or uneven coatings within a year or two.
